Balfour Beatty starts work on £30m Sheffield Hallam University building

20 Feb 14 Balfour Beatty has begun construction work on a £30m building contract for Sheffield Hallam University.

The two-block, seven-storey building on Charles Street, in the heart of Sheffield’s ‘cultural industries quarter’, will house the University’s Sheffield Institute of Education and will include a lecture theatre, cafes, flexible teaching spaces, event hosting spaces, and a data centre. Total space is 10,000m2.

Balfour Beatty’s contract is worth £23m.

Sited next to Butcher Works, a Grade II listed building, a central atrium will enclose the historical road, Brown Lane, which will run through the middle of the development maintaining the historical grid of the area. The design is deliberately sympathetic to the local heritage of the area and the use of traditional brickwork and Corten steel will align the development with the industrial nature of the surrounding buildings.

A link bridge, designed by Sheffield based designer Corin Mellor, will join the new building to the existing Arundel Building.

Balfour Beatty is using building information modelling (BIM) to create a full 4D design to aid the construction programme. BIM will also provide the basis for a building management system on handover.

Balfour Beatty Engineering Services will deliver mechanical and electrical (M&E) services including the data centre and solar panels.  The building will also have a sedum roof to minimise its carbon footprint.

Balfour Beatty regional managing director Jon Adams said: “This project builds on our comprehensive portfolio in the higher education sector, in which we have been particularly successful in recent months. We are committed to working in collaboration with Sheffield Hallam University to deliver a prestigious new University building which meets the needs of their students and partners now and into the future.”

Balfour Beatty Ground Engineering will commence piling works on the project next month and the building will be completed in the autumn 2015.

Balfour Beatty is also currently completing construction works on the University of Sheffield’s New Engineering Building.
